Message for U.S. Citizens: Embassy and Consulate General Closed for Public Services on February 15 Election Day

The Indonesian government has declared a national holiday on Wednesday, February 15 to give Indonesian citizens the opportunity to vote in gubernatorial and other local elections in many areas of the country.  Therefore, the Consular Sections at the U.S. Embassy in Jakarta and the U.S. Consulate General in Surabaya as well as the Consular Agency in Bali will be closed to the public for routine visa and American citizen services.  Emergency services for U.S. citizens will remain available.

Please also note that the U.S. Embassy in Jakarta, the Consulate General in Surabaya, the Consulate in Medan, and the Consular Agency in Bali will also be closed on Monday, February 20 for Washington’s Birthday, also known as Presidents’ Day, a U.S. holiday.
